Influences of Neck and/or Wrist Pain on Hand Grip Strength of Industrial Quality Proofing Workers.

The aim of this study was to analyze the interaction between neck and/or wrist pain and hand grip strength (HGS) and to investigate factors (age, sex, neck disorders, and carpal tunnel syndrome) influencing the HGS of industrial quality proofing workers ( Standardized questionnaires [Neck Disability Index (NDI), Boston Carpal Tunnel Questionnaire] were used to evaluate existing neck and/or wrist pain. HGS measurements were performed in different wrist positions. Significant differences between participants with and without neck pain were found in different wrist positions, in neutral wrist position right [without neck pain ( Neck pain has an impact on HGS but should be evaluated in consideration of age and sex.
